I've been trying to install two different versions: 5.0.6 and 6.1.3. None of them have been able to detect any of my NICs:

 

- Intel DX58SO with Intel 82567LF Gigabit and a PCI NIC: Intel i350-T4

- X99-DELUXE with Intel I218V and Intel I211-AT

 

Is this normal? The boot process runs normally and uses an "eth0" for DHCP, however it does not get an IP and finishes with the Tower login prompt. On my switch, none of the "link-up" lights turns on, meaning there is no connection at all, happening with two motherboards and one PCI NIC.
